Light rays from an object point reflect from a plane mirror as though they came from the image point. Light rays from an object at p refract as though they came from the image point p". Construction for determining the location of the image formed by a plane mirror. Characteristics of the image from a plane mirror. The image is just as far behind the mirror as the object is in front of the mirror: s = -s". The lateral magnification is: m = y"/y. The image is virtual (no real light rays reach the image), erect, reversed, and the same size as the object.
